Package: box64 Version: 0.1.8-1 Architecture: arm64 Maintainer: Johannes Schauer Marin Rodrigues Installed-Size: 7648 Depends: libc6 (>= 2.34), libstdc++6:amd64 Homepage: https://github.com/ptitSeb/box64 Priority: optional Section: utils Filename: pool/main/b/box64/box64_0.1.8-1_arm64.deb Size: 1220304 SHA256: 0aa49b36880e8b490c2cc970697fca369fb006a749f058e26a3d1c4f740ba54f SHA1: 6c12727f57131c42faac816822b51d4843a3ced0 MD5sum: 7e2ef6522d5590ff88cd53f0907ad2a8 Description: run amd64 binaries on arm64 without emulating library calls Using DynaRec on arm64, box64 will dynamically recompile x64_64 code to aarch64 but will also translate calls to foreign library functions to native library calls. This usually makes amd64 executables run via box64 much faster than emulating amd64 on arm64 via qemu which will emulate everything down to the C library. For example OpenArena emulated with box64 will be at about 85% of its native speed. Package: hyperv-daemons Source: linux Version: 5.19.6-1+reform1 Architecture: arm64 Maintainer: Debian Kernel Team Installed-Size: 729 Pre-Depends: init-system-helpers (>= 1.54~) Depends: lsb-base, libc6 (>= 2.34) Homepage: https://www.kernel.org/ Priority: optional Section: admin Filename: pool/main/l/linux/hyperv-daemons_5.19.6-1+reform1_arm64.deb Size: 514740 SHA256: 1dd5a999d1b21405638783a096b5302bf9b912e3485ba53ae672ed5bf3fefbb4 SHA1: 5d11e15d64c45c9b10bd2d12db53c5a937347cc6 MD5sum: f66a576d547d36426d723d6117402994 Description: Support daemons for Linux running on Hyper-V Suite of daemons for Linux guests running on Hyper-V, consisting of hv_fcopy_daemon, hv_kvp_daemon and hv_vss_daemon. . hv_fcopy_daemon provides the file copy service, allowing the host to copy files into the guest. . hv_kvp_daemon provides the key-value pair (KVP) service, allowing the host to get and set the IP networking configuration of the guest. (This requires helper scripts which are not currently included.) . hv_vss_daemon provides the volume shadow copy service (VSS), allowing the host to freeze the guest filesystems while taking a snapshot. Package: usbip Source: linux (5.19.6-1+reform1) Version: 2.0+5.19.6-1+reform1 Architecture: arm64 Maintainer: Debian Kernel Team Installed-Size: 626 Depends: usb.ids, libc6 (>= 2.34), libudev1 (>= 183), libwrap0 (>= 7.6-4~) Homepage: https://www.kernel.org/ Priority: optional Section: admin Filename: pool/main/l/linux/usbip_2.0+5.19.6-1+reform1_arm64.deb Size: 531728 SHA256: f3c566eeafeb61fbe7b0d6ff34182400f16d7c435da3c179825be790c0646150 SHA1: bef631990258bc9be4b25b7a75cd70dd21c1e75b MD5sum: 0370224a5909c7fa29c3f5eb82d0c3a0 Description: USB device sharing system over IP network USB/IP is a system for sharing USB devices over the network. . To share USB devices between computers with their full functionality, USB/IP encapsulates "USB requests" into IP packets and transmits them between computers. . Original USB device drivers and applications can be used for remote USB devices without any modification of them. A computer can use remote USB devices as if they were directly attached. . Currently USB/IP provides no access control or encryption. It should only be used in trusted environments. . This package provides the server component 'usbipd' and the client tool 'usbip'.
